What Is Pertex Fabric?
Pertex is a family of high-performance, lightweight nylon and polyester fabrics engineered for outdoor apparel, particularly in jackets, shells, and insulated garments. The brand is known for delivering exceptional wind resistance, breathability, and packability while keeping weight low. Pertex fabrics are not a single material but a range of constructions optimized for different weather conditions and use cases.
Material Composition
Pertex uses tightly woven nylon or polyester yarns, often with a DWR (Durable Water Repellent) finish. Some variants incorporate a microporous membrane or coating for full waterproofing. The base fabric is designed to be ultra-lightweight yet durable, with deniers as low as 7D in some Quantum constructions.
Waterproofing and Breathability
Not all Pertex fabrics are waterproof. The Pertex Shield line includes a membrane that provides a hydrostatic head up to 20,000 mm, making it fully waterproof and breathable. Other lines like Quantum and Air are water-resistant rather than waterproof, relying on tight weaves and DWR to shed light rain while allowing moisture vapor to escape.
Durability and Weight
Pertex fabrics are thin but tough. For example, Pertex Quantum Pro uses a diamond ripstop pattern for added tear resistance, weighing as little as 30 g/m². This makes it ideal for down jackets where every gram counts. Even the heavier Shield variants stay under 100 g/m², far lighter than many traditional hard shells.
How Pertex Differs From Standard Nylon or Polyester
Standard nylon and polyester fabrics lack the engineered weave structures and coatings that give Pertex its performance edge. The table below highlights critical differences that matter for outdoor jacket brands.
Weight and Packability Advantage
Pertex fabrics are often 30-50% lighter than generic nylon shells of equivalent durability. This translates to jackets that compress into a small stuff sack, a key selling point for backpacking and ultralight brands.
Breathability Without Membrane
Pertex Air achieves high air permeability (80+ CFM) without a membrane, using a specialized weave that allows moisture vapor to escape while still blocking wind. This makes it a top choice for running jackets and high-output layers.
Choosing the Right Pertex Fabric for Your Jacket: Quantum, Shield, Air
Each Pertex line targets a specific performance niche. The table below helps you match the fabric to your jacket’s intended use, then we’ll break down each line in detail.
Pertex Quantum
Quantum is the go-to for ultralight wind shells and down jackets. Its tight weave blocks wind and contains down feathers while allowing moisture vapor to escape. The Pro version adds a diamond ripstop grid for tear resistance. If your brand targets the fastpacking or ultralight hiking market, Quantum delivers the weight-to-warmth ratio that sells.
Pertex Shield
Shield is a full waterproof/breathable membrane system. It comes in 2, 2.5, and 3-layer constructions, with performance comparable to mid-range Gore-Tex but at a lower cost. The 3-layer version is durable enough for mountaineering shells, while the 2.5-layer is lighter and more packable. Shield jackets can retail from $150 to $350, offering strong margins.
Pertex Air
Air is a soft, stretchy fabric with exceptionally high air permeability. It’s not waterproof but dries fast and allows moisture vapor to escape rapidly. It’s ideal for high-output aerobic activities like trail running and cross-country skiing. The fabric’s soft hand feel also works well for lifestyle jackets with a technical edge.

Seam Sealing and Bonding
Pertex Shield jackets require fully taped seams to remain waterproof. Our sample development process includes seam sealing calibration to ensure the tape bonds correctly with the membrane. For non-waterproof Quantum and Air jackets, we typically use enclosed seams or flatlock stitching to maintain comfort while reducing production cost. Incorrect seam sealing can lead to delamination, so we perform a 24-hour water-bath test on every Shield production batch.

What is Pertex fabric made of?
Pertex fabrics are primarily made from tightly woven nylon or polyester yarns. Some variants, like Pertex Shield, incorporate a microporous polyurethane membrane for waterproofness, while others use a DWR coating. The yarns are often ultra-fine denier, allowing for lightweight, wind-resistant, and packable constructions.
Is Pertex fabric waterproof?
Only the Pertex Shield line is fully waterproof, with a hydrostatic head rating of up to 20,000 mm. Other Pertex fabrics like Quantum and Air are water-resistant due to tight weaves and DWR treatment, but they will eventually wet through in sustained rain. For a rain shell, Shield is the correct choice.
Is Pertex better than Gore-Tex?
Pertex Shield and Gore-Tex are both waterproof breathable membranes, but they target different price points. Pertex Shield offers comparable performance at a lower cost, making it ideal for brands that want a premium feel without the top-tier pricing. Gore-Tex typically has higher brand recognition, but Pertex Shield can be a strong value alternative.
What is the difference between Pertex Quantum and Pertex Shield?
Pertex Quantum is a lightweight, wind-resistant, and downproof fabric used in insulated jackets and wind shells. It is not waterproof. Pertex Shield is a fully waterproof and breathable membrane system designed for rain shells and hardshells. Quantum is much lighter (30-50 g/m²) and more packable, while Shield is heavier but provides complete weather protection.
Is Pertex fabric durable?
Yes, Pertex fabrics are designed for durability despite their light weight. Pertex Quantum Pro uses a diamond ripstop grid to resist tears, and Pertex Shield 3-layer constructions are built for alpine use. However, ultralight versions like 7D Quantum are more delicate and best suited for low-abrasion activities like backpacking under a shell.
